Katy ISD Spelling Bee 2019 Winners


KATY MAGAZINE NEWS

March 10, 2019

W-I-N-N-E-R-S that spells Winners!! Katy Independent School District was proud to announce their recent 2019 Katy ISD Spelling Bee Winners. Spelling out the winning word “drupaceous”.

Photo Attribution: Left: Beckendorff Junior High Keerthana Krishnan Grade 7 Champion Center: Memorial Parkway Junior High Beck Beathard Grade 7 Runner-Up Right: Seven Lakes Junior High Janina Ojeiduma Grade 8 Alternate

21 Rounds of Competition

The winning word was “drupaceous” which Beckendorff Junior High Keerthana Krishnan spelled out without hesitation. The seventh-grader went through a rigorous 21 rounds of competition to ultimately be recognized as the Spelling Bee Champion of Katy ISD.

Runner Up

Memorial Parkway Junior High seventh-grader Beck Beathard was named the Spelling Bee Runner-up and Janina Ojeiduma, an eighth-grader from Seven Lakes Junior High was named Spelling Bee Alternate.

“The hard work, determination and countless hours spent by these Katy ISD students to prepare for such competition is a clear demonstration of their passion to excel in whatever they set their minds to,” said Katy ISD Instructional Officer for Curriculum and Instruction Lisa Wells.

“Students are excited for the District’s competition and we know they will represent Katy ISD well,” added Wells.

Scripps National Spelling Bee

Keerthana and Beck will represent Katy ISD at the Houston Public Media Regional Spelling Beeon March 23. The Champion and Runner-up at the Regional Spelling Bee event will then advance to the Scripps National Spelling Bee in Washington D.C. in May 2019.
